Cheerly

adj, adv

Definitions

Adjective
  1. 1
    Cheerful, gay; not gloomy. archaic

    "Wel ſaid, thou look'ſt cheerely, / And Ile be with thee quickly: yet thou lieſt / In the bleake aire."

Adverb
  1. 1
    Cheerily, cheerfully, heartily; briskly. archaic

    "My louing Lord, I take my leaue of you, [...] Not ſicke, although I haue to do with death, / But luſtie, yong, and cheerely drawing breath."

Etymology

Etymology 1

From cheer + -ly.

Etymology 2

From Middle English cheerly, cherly, cherely, cheerliche, equivalent to cheer + -ly.
